WebMake sure that you use a scraper to remove any droppings that have dried onto hard surfaces such as the roosts. You then want to spray all the surfaces with a vinegar and water mixture to disinfect them. Allow the inside of the coop to dry completely before you add new bedding material and let the chickens back in. WebSep 26, 2024 · Spread a thin layer of barn lime (calcium carbonate or crushed limestone, not hydrated lime) to help with odor and fly control, on the floor of the coop. Over the barn lime, you’ll want to add 4-6 inches of fresh bedding; pine shavings work best ( never use cedar). Stir the litter every 21 days or so, adding more barn lime and fresh shavings ...
